Hachi – hat im Februar 2019 ein Zuhause gefunden

Mixed Breed · Unknown

Hachi is an upright and exceptionally friendly mixed breed. He knows what he wants and is also keen to test his boundaries. However, he is also clever and quickly realizes when something doesn’t work and will then gladly give in. He gets along well with fellow animals, although he hasn’t had any experiences with cats yet. Hachi enjoys the company of his humans, is happy to go anywhere with them, and is a faithful companion. Hachi is looking for a new home with loving people, ideally those with some dog experience who will attend dog training classes with him and help him refine his alone time. A home without small children would be best. Hachi is vaccinated, microchipped, and ready for rehoming. 🇨🇭Adopting from Switzerland

Swiss shelters require a home visit (Platzkontrolle) and proof of suitable accommodation. Cantons each have their own additional dog-keeping requirements (e.g. SKN training in some areas). Animals leave sterilized and chipped.

Can I adopt Hachi – hat im Februar 2019 ein Zuhause gefunden if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— Tierschutzbund Basel Regional will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
